Ro Water Treatment in Nashville, TN
RO water treatment services involve the installation, maintenance, and repair of systems designed to purify tap water using reverse osmosis technology. These services typically cover projects such as upgrading existing water filtration systems, installing new units for homes or properties with specific water quality concerns, and ensuring the proper operation of these systems to produce clean, safe drinking water. Property owners often seek information about system capacity, maintenance requirements, and the types of contaminants that can be effectively removed to determine if RO treatment is suitable for their household needs.
Before requesting RO water treatment services, homeowners should understand their water quality and any specific issues they want addressed, such as high mineral content, odors, or contaminants. It’s also helpful to consider the space available for system installation, the ongoing maintenance involved, and the expected lifespan of the equipment. Clarifying these details can ensure the chosen system meets the household’s water quality goals and functions efficiently over time.

Ro Water Treatment Questions
What is RO water treatment? Reverse osmosis (RO) water treatment is a process that removes impurities and contaminants from tap water, providing cleaner, better-tasting water for household use.
What types of property projects use RO water treatment? RO systems are commonly used in homes, apartments, and small commercial properties to improve water quality for drinking, cooking, and appliances.
How does RO water treatment improve water quality? It filters out sediments, chlorine, heavy metals, and other impurities, resulting in clearer, safer water for everyday consumption.
Is RO water treatment suitable for all water sources? RO systems work well with municipal tap water and well water, but the specific setup may vary based on the water source and quality.
